Leaders of the Kisan Mazdoor Morcha (KMM) and the Samyukt Kisan Morcha (SKM) held a meeting to discuss prospects of unity between both platforms.

Advertisement

KMM leaders described the meeting as positive and constructive, expressing confidence that both forums might hold joint programmes under a common minimum programme in the near future.

Advertisement

The meeting took place in a cordial environment with detailed discussions. SKM leaders said they would place the matter before their general body for discussion.

The KMM criticised CM Bhagwant Mann for allegedly failing to take floods seriously. Farmers across the state have suffered massive losses, yet the government has failed to respond effectively. The government should provide Rs 70,000 per acre compensation to affected farmers and Rs 7,000 to agricultural labourers.
